Participation in education at all levels has expanded greatly in India in the last two decades and investment at the secondary level has been prioritized to meet increasing demand arising from the success of Sarva Shiksha Abhiyan SSA – a programme for universalizing elementary education and increased capacity of the secondary education system. The goal of Rashtriya Madhyamik Shiksha Abhiyan (RMSA) is universal access to secondary education.
The agenda to expand access is very challenging. It is not simply the volume of demand, but the fact that new secondary entrants will increasingly come from disadvantaged background. This will place greater challenges on the education system. These children will require more support and better-quality teaching and will lack academic assistance from within their households.
